My father is staying at Gateway Gardens. It's an excellent home. It's very spacious, level, and clean. The staff is very kind and very attentive. They have music, they go to church, there's reading, and painting. They were having an Easter celebration when we were there last. The food is excellent. They cook there in the facility and the food is presentable and looks appetizing.

I had a family member stay here before suffering an hip fracture resulting in death. Falls are not unheard with the elderly and dementia but five falls during a gait belt transfer should not happen. Care staff has some great caring people but as a whole understaffed and lack proper training.

The memory care part of the Gateway Gardens was kind of enclosed and dreary. I was not impressed. They had to share a bedroom with a person, and I could not imagine my husband sharing a bedroom with somebody. It was a locked down situation. They had a walkway that people could walk on that went into an open patio, but the grounds were not too inviting. It was not awful. It just was small and kind of confining. The rooms seemed pretty small and not too bright. My daughter looked at me and I looked at her and I said: “Oh my God! Let’s leave.”
